Designed for Professional Wireless Data Communication
Unlike conventional wireless bridges, this broadband wireless data link is optimized for simultaneous transmission of Ethernet data, serial commands, and flight control information.
The dual Ethernet interfaces operate in transparent bridge mode, allowing existing IP devices such as network cameras, embedded computers, industrial controllers, and mission systems to communicate without additional protocol conversion.
The two UART interfaces support transparent wireless serial transmission, making integration with sensors, PLCs, telemetry devices, and embedded systems simple and reliable.
The integrated SBUS interface is especially suitable for UAV flight control systems requiring low-latency control signal transmission.

Network Modes
The wireless system supports multiple deployment architectures:
- Point-to-Point wireless communication
- Point-to-Multipoint star network
- Customized Mesh networking
Maximum supported nodes:
- Star network: ما يصل الى 64 العقد
- شبكة شبكية: ما يصل الى 32 العقد
The intelligent bandwidth management automatically allocates available throughput among connected nodes to maximize network efficiency.
واجهات
The device includes:
- 2 × Transparent Ethernet Ports
- 2 × Transparent UART Serial Ports
- 1 × SBUS Interface
- Dual RF Antenna Connectors (الشركات عبر الوطنية)
- DC Power Input
The Ethernet interfaces are internally bridged with the same IP address, simplifying network deployment.
UART interfaces support transparent wireless serial communication or Serial-to-Ethernet operation.
